I recently had surgery to remove a cyst near my front tooth in the upper jawline, and the bone in that area has melted. How long does it usually take for the bone to regenerate after something like this? Also, what are the chances of the cyst coming back and is there anything I can do to prevent it from recurring?

Doctor 1

Answered by 1 Apollo Doctors

Bone healing usually takes 3–6 months; recurrence risk is low if properly cleaned—regular dental follow-up helps.
